📘 Series Summary
Returning to the character he co-created, writer Tony Isabella brings Jefferson Pierce back to the streets in Black Lightning Volume 2. Set in the harsh environment of "Brick City," this series strips away the global stakes of the Justice League and Outsiders to focus on the violent urban decay threatening Jefferson's community. With visceral, moody artwork by Eddy Newell, the series is a standout of mid-90s street-level superheroics.
The 13-issue run follows Black Lightning as he wages a one-man war against gangs like the Royal Family and powerful adversaries such as Painkiller and the cyborg Demolition. The narrative reaches a fever pitch during a brutal gang war involving the vigilante Gangbuster and culminates in a hunt for the serial killer "Sick Nick," where Jefferson must clear his name of murder. This volume is remembered for its social commentary, intense action, and a high-profile series finale guest-starring Batman.
⭐ Why This Series Stands Out
Written by character co-creator Tony Isabella, ensuring an authentic and powerful voice for Jefferson Pierce.
Features Painkiller's first appearance (Issue #2), a character who became a major antagonist in the Black Lightning TV series.
A gritty, 90s urban noir aesthetic provided by the unique, heavy-line art style of Eddy Newell.
Explores Jefferson Pierce’s dual life as an educator and a vigilante, emphasizing the "Teacher" aspect of his character.
Includes a significant 3-part "Gang War" crossover with the Metropolis hero Gangbuster.
The series finale (Issue #13) features a definitive Batman team-up, reconnecting Jefferson with his Outsiders history.
